Driveshaft Failure Due to Improper Heat Treatment
Driveshaft failure can cause a sudden loss of drive power, increasing the risk of a crash.

Summary
NTN Bearing Corporation of America (NTN) is recalling certain NTN Columbus, and NTN Anderson Driveshafts. Please see the recall report for a full list of part numbers. The driveshaft assemblies may have internal components that were not heat-treated properly, possibly resulting in driveshaft failure.
Remedy
NTN will reimburse the vehicle manufacturers, and vehicle manufacturers will determine the appropriate remedy for their vehicles and provide owner notifications. Honda

Chronology :
September 23, 2021
NTN Driveshaft Anderson, Inc. identified a steel ball component issue from a hard to install condition of the joint sub-assembly. Hardness confirmation of steel ball component confirmed insufficiently heat-treated steel balls. NTN Driveshaft Columbus was also notified.
September 27, 2021
Tier-2 supplier of the steel ball component confirmed only specific production lots received abnormal heat-treatment due to improper air/gas mixture and temperature variation from furnace misfires.
September 30, 2021
NTN Driveshaft Anderson, Inc. informed Honda
of potentially suspect driveshafts that were shipped to Honda
.
These potentially suspect driveshafts were assembled with insufficiently heat-treated steel balls for the front drives shaft outboard joint sub-assembly.
October 4, 202
NTN Driveshaft Columbus informed GM of the potentially suspect Driveshafts shipped to GM plant. These potentially suspect driveshafts were also assembled with insufficiently heat-treated steel balls for the front drives shaft outboard joint sub-assembly.
Mid-October to mid-November, 2021
NTN completed reproduction testing of the potentially suspect parts. After continued use, the steel balls could deform from heat generated by the driveshaft, resulting in outboard joint sub-assembly seizure and driveshaft failure.
November 25, 2021
Honda
determined that a defect related to motor vehicle safety existed and decided to conduct a safety recall.

How Remedy Component Differs
from Recalled Component :
Proper heat-treatment of the steel ball component assembled into the
driveshaft component
Identify How/When Recall Condition
was Corrected in Production :
June 4th, 2021
Defect condition- Improper air/gas mixture from soot buildup on air
supply valve caused furnace misfires which led to improper heat-treatment.
June 6th, 2021
Corrected condition- Air/gas mixing valve adjustment to eliminate misfire
of the heat-treat furnace for proper heat treatment and connected
continuous monitoring data logger system for low temperature in heat-treat
furnace.
